In the competitive landscape of CS:GO, mastering the art of wallbanging can be the difference between a glorious victory and a frustrating defeat. Wallbang spots, or locations where players can shoot through walls to hit enemies, are often underutilized. Among the top CS:GO wallbang spots you never knew existed, several are game-changers, especially on maps like Dust II and Mirage. For instance, if you find yourself on Dust II, learning the precise angles to shoot through the doors from Terrorist spawn can catch unsuspecting enemies off guard, giving you the upper hand right from the start.
Another hidden gem is located on Mirage, where you can exploit the wall between A site and Mid. By positioning yourself just outside the A site balcony, you can effectively hit opponents peeking from the Window. To maximize your effectiveness, consider utilizing armor-piercing weapons like the AWP or MP7 for these specific wallbangs. Understanding and executing these techniques not only enhances your gameplay but also elevates your team’s strategy, making you a formidable opponent in any match.

Counter-Strike: Global Offensive (CS:GO) has long captivated players with its intricate mechanics and strategic depth. Among these mechanics, the wallbang concept stands out as a testament to the game’s complexity. Wallbanging allows players to shoot through walls and obstacles, often resulting in surprising eliminations that defy common expectations. However, some wallbangs in CS:GO are bizarre and counterintuitive. For instance, the ability to penetrate certain surfaces with specific weapons can lead to a tragic yet humorous demise for opponents who underestimate the power of a well-placed bullet. These peculiar mechanics not only challenge players' understanding of the game but also add an exciting layer to the tactical gameplay.
To truly master these unusual wallbangs, players must familiarize themselves with the game's diverse maps and the materials that construct them. The interaction between different weapons and surfaces plays a crucial role in determining whether a wallbang will be effective. For example, some walls may seem impenetrable, yet a well-aimed shot from a powerful sniper rifle could yield devastating results.
